暗号資産 (仮想通貨)分散型アプリ(DApp)の種類と使い方
はじめに
暗号資産(仮想通貨)技術の発展に伴い、ブロックチェーン技術を活用した分散型アプリケーション(DApp)が注目を集めています。DAppは、従来の集中型アプリケーションとは異なり、単一の主体に制御されない、透明性が高く、改ざんが困難な特性を持っています。本稿では、DAppの種類とそれぞれの使い方について、詳細に解説します。
DAppとは何か?
DAppは、分散型台帳技術(DLT)であるブロックチェーン上で動作するアプリケーションです。その特徴として、以下の点が挙げられます。
- 分散性: 中央集権的なサーバーに依存せず、ネットワーク参加者によってデータが共有・管理されます。
- 透明性: ブロックチェーン上の取引履歴は公開されており、誰でも確認できます。
- 不変性: 一度記録されたデータは改ざんが極めて困難です。
- 自律性: スマートコントラクトと呼ばれるプログラムによって、自動的に処理が実行されます。
これらの特徴により、DAppは金融、ゲーム、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。
DAppの種類
DAppは、その機能や用途によって様々な種類に分類できます。以下に代表的なDAppの種類を紹介します。
1. DeFi (分散型金融)
DeFiは、従来の金融システムをブロックチェーン上で再現するDAppの総称です。銀行や証券会社などの仲介業者を介さずに、個人間で直接金融取引を行うことができます。
- 分散型取引所 (DEX): ユーザーが暗号資産を直接交換できるプラットフォームです。Uniswap、SushiSwapなどが代表的です。
- レンディングプラットフォーム: 暗号資産を貸し借りできるプラットフォームです。Aave、Compoundなどが代表的です。
- ステーブルコイン: 米ドルなどの法定通貨に価値が連動するように設計された暗号資産です。DAI、USDCなどが代表的です。
- イールドファーミング: 暗号資産を特定のDAppに預け入れることで、報酬を得る仕組みです。
DeFiは、金融包摂の促進、取引コストの削減、透明性の向上などのメリットが期待されています。
2. NFT (非代替性トークン)
NFTは、デジタル資産の所有権を証明するためのトークンです。アート、音楽、ゲームアイテムなど、ユニークなデジタルコンテンツの所有権を表現するために使用されます。
- デジタルアートマーケットプレイス: NFTアートの売買を行うプラットフォームです。OpenSea、Raribleなどが代表的です。
- ゲーム内アイテム: ゲーム内で使用できるアイテムをNFTとして発行し、プレイヤーが自由に売買できるようにします。
- コレクティブル: 限定版のデジタルカードやキャラクターなどをNFTとして発行し、コレクションアイテムとして楽しむことができます。
NFTは、デジタルコンテンツの価値創造、クリエイターへの収益還元、新たなビジネスモデルの創出などの可能性を秘めています。
3. ゲーム
ブロックチェーン技術を活用したゲームは、プレイヤーがゲーム内で獲得したアイテムや通貨を暗号資産として所有し、自由に売買できるという特徴があります。
- Play-to-Earn (P2E) ゲーム: ゲームをプレイすることで暗号資産を獲得できるゲームです。Axie Infinity、The Sandboxなどが代表的です。
- ブロックチェーンゲームプラットフォーム: 複数のブロックチェーンゲームを統合し、プレイヤーが共通のウォレットでゲーム資産を管理できるようにします。
ブロックチェーンゲームは、ゲーム体験の向上、プレイヤーへの経済的インセンティブの提供、新たなゲームエコシステムの構築などの可能性を秘めています。
4. ソーシャルメディア
ブロックチェーン技術を活用したソーシャルメディアは、ユーザーがコンテンツを作成・共有することで暗号資産を獲得できるという特徴があります。
- 分散型SNS: 中央集権的な管理者が存在せず、ユーザーが自由にコンテンツを投稿・共有できるSNSです。Steemit、Mindsなどが代表的です。
- コンテンツクリエーター向けプラットフォーム: クリエイターがコンテンツを公開し、ファンから直接支援を受けられるプラットフォームです。
ブロックチェーンソーシャルメディアは、言論の自由の保護、コンテンツクリエーターへの収益還元、新たなソーシャルメディア体験の提供などの可能性を秘めています。
5. サプライチェーン管理
ブロックチェーン技術を活用したサプライチェーン管理システムは、製品の製造から販売までの過程を追跡し、透明性と信頼性を向上させることができます。
- トレーサビリティ: 製品の原産地、製造過程、輸送履歴などをブロックチェーン上に記録し、消費者が製品の情報を確認できるようにします。
- 偽造防止: ブロックチェーンの不変性を利用して、偽造品の流通を防止します。
ブロックチェーンサプライチェーン管理は、製品の品質向上、ブランドイメージの保護、効率的なサプライチェーンの構築などのメリットが期待されています。
DAppの使い方
DAppを利用するには、以下の手順が必要です。
1. 暗号資産ウォレットの準備
DAppを利用するには、暗号資産を保管するためのウォレットが必要です。MetaMask、Trust Walletなどが代表的なウォレットです。
2. ウォレットへの暗号資産のチャージ
DAppを利用するには、ウォレットにDAppで使用する暗号資産をチャージする必要があります。暗号資産取引所で購入した暗号資産をウォレットに送金します。
3. DAppへの接続
DAppのウェブサイトにアクセスし、ウォレットを接続します。ウォレットの種類によっては、DAppへの接続を許可する必要があります。
4. DAppの利用
ウォレットを接続した後、DAppの機能を利用できます。取引の実行、コンテンツの投稿、ゲームのプレイなど、DAppによって利用できる機能は異なります。
DApp利用時の注意点
DAppを利用する際には、以下の点に注意する必要があります。
- スマートコントラクトのリスク: スマートコントラクトにはバグが含まれている可能性があり、資金を失うリスクがあります。
- セキュリティリスク: ウォレットの秘密鍵が漏洩すると、資金を盗まれるリスクがあります。
- 詐欺: 詐欺的なDAppが存在するため、利用するDAppを慎重に選択する必要があります。
これらのリスクを理解し、適切な対策を講じることで、DAppを安全に利用することができます。
まとめ
DAppは、ブロックチェーン技術を活用した革新的なアプリケーションであり、様々な分野での応用が期待されています。DeFi、NFT、ゲーム、ソーシャルメディア、サプライチェーン管理など、様々な種類のDAppが存在し、それぞれ異なる特徴と用途を持っています。DAppを利用する際には、暗号資産ウォレットの準備、ウォレットへの暗号資産のチャージ、DAppへの接続などの手順が必要であり、スマートコントラクトのリスク、セキュリティリスク、詐欺などの注意点も考慮する必要があります。DAppは、従来の集中型アプリケーションとは異なる、新たな可能性を秘めた技術であり、今後の発展が期待されます。